DescriptionIn rw_i93_sm_set_read_only of rw_i93.cc, there is a possible out of bounds write due to a missing bounds check. This could lead to remote code execution over NFC with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is needed for exploitation.Product: AndroidVersions: Android-8.0 Android-8.1 Android-9 Android-10Android ID: A-139188579
